June 2023 gold market: Higher-for-longer rates weigh

Bearish

A hawkish 'skip' and resilient economy pressured gold.

Gold eased toward $1,920 in June as the Federal Reserve 'skipped' a hike but signalled more tightening ahead, and a resilient US economy pushed back rate-cut bets. Rising real yields gradually sapped the metal's momentum.

The 2023 gold market: Banking crisis and another record CB buy year

Silicon Valley Bank failed in March 2023, followed by Credit Suisse rescue. Gold rallied to $2,072 in May, then traded $1,820–$2,090 through year-end. Central banks bought another 1,037 tonnes — second-highest ever. Year close: $2,062.

Era context — The modern bull market (2019 to today)

Gold's second major bull market of the 21st century. Driven by COVID stimulus, Russia sanctions, central-bank accumulation at record levels, and the structural shift toward a multi-polar reserve system. New all-time highs reached repeatedly since 2020.

How South Korea gold prices are calculated on this page

Source. The international XAU/USD spot price comes from gold-api.com's historical archive (London PM-fix benchmark). The KRW/USD exchange rate comes from exchangerate-api.com's 2023 year-end snapshot.

Conversion. Every KRW figure on this page is computed as XAU/USD price × KRW/USD rate. We use the year-end exchange rate consistently across all June 2023 prices on this page.

Per-unit math. Per-gram = per-ounce ÷ 31.1035. Per-tola = per-gram × 11.664. Per-10g = per-gram × 10. Per-kilo = per-gram × 1000. Karat values multiply per-gram by the purity ratio (24K = 0.999, 22K = 0.916, 21K = 0.875, 18K = 0.750, 14K = 0.585, 10K = 0.417).

What this page does NOT include. Local sales tax / VAT, customs duty on imports, dealer making charges, jewellery design premiums, or coin numismatic premiums. Why does the retail price in shops differ from this number?

The ₩ figures here represent the international gold spot price converted to KRW at the 2023-end exchange rate. South Korea's retail jewellers add (1) import duties and sales tax (varies by SKU and karat), (2) dealer making charges (typically 3–12% of metal value), and (3) a small premium for purity certification on bars.
